#cbce0f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cbce0f is composed of 79.6% red, 80.8%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.7%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 60.9 degrees, a saturation of 86.4% and a lightness of 43.3%. #cbce0f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1e with #979d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

Shades and Tints of #cbce0f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050500 is the darkest color, while #fefef2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cbce0f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#70716d is the less saturated color, while #d3d707 is the most saturated one.
